| #include "bspatch.h" |
| |
| static int64_t offtin(uint8_t *buf) |
| { |
| int64_t y; |
| |
| y=buf[7]&0x7F; |
| y=y*256;y+=buf[6]; |
| y=y*256;y+=buf[5]; |
| y=y*256;y+=buf[4]; |
| y=y*256;y+=buf[3]; |
| y=y*256;y+=buf[2]; |
| y=y*256;y+=buf[1]; |
| y=y*256;y+=buf[0]; |
| |
| if(buf[7]&0x80) y=-y; |
| |
| return y; |
| } |
| |
| int bspatch(const uint8_t* old, int64_t oldsize, uint8_t* newff, int64_t newsize, struct bspatch_stream* stream) |
| { |
| uint8_t buf[8]; |
| int64_t oldpos,newpos; |
| int64_t ctrl[3]; |
| int64_t i; |
| |
| oldpos=0;newpos=0; |
| while(newpos<newsize) { |
| /* Read control data */ |
| for(i=0;i<=2;i++) { |
| if (stream->read(stream, buf, 8)) |
| return -1; |
| ctrl[i]=offtin(buf); |
| }; |
| |
| /* Sanity-check */ |
| if(newpos+ctrl[0]>newsize) |
| return -1; |
| |
| /* Read diff string */ |
| if (stream->read(stream, newff + newpos, ctrl[0])) |
| return -1; |
| |
| /* Add old data to diff string */ |
| for(i=0;i<ctrl[0];i++) |
| if((oldpos+i>=0) && (oldpos+i<oldsize)) |
| newff[newpos+i]+=old[oldpos+i]; |
| |
| /* Adjust pointers */ |
| newpos+=ctrl[0]; |
| oldpos+=ctrl[0]; |
| |
| /* Sanity-check */ |
| if(newpos+ctrl[1]>newsize) |
| return -1; |
| |
| /* Read extra string */ |
| if (stream->read(stream, newff + newpos, ctrl[1])) |
| return -1; |
| |
| /* Adjust pointers */ |
| newpos+=ctrl[1]; |
| oldpos+=ctrl[2]; |
| }; |
| |
| return 0; |
| } |

| #include <bzlib.h> |
| #include <stdlib.h> |
| #include <stdint.h> |
| #include <stdio.h> |
| #include <string.h> |
| #include <err.h> |
| #include <sys/types.h> |
| #include <sys/stat.h> |
| #include <unistd.h> |
| #include <fcntl.h> |
| |
| int bz2_read(const struct bspatch_stream* stream, void* buffer, int length) |
| { |
| int n; |
| int bz2err; |
| BZFILE* bz2; |
| |
| bz2 = (BZFILE*)stream->opaque; |
| n = BZ2_bzRead(&bz2err, bz2, buffer, length); |
| if (n != length) |
| return -1; |
| |
| return 0; |
| } |
| |
| int apply_bsdiff_patch(const char *oldfile, const char *newfile, const char *patch) |
| { |
| FILE * f; |
| int fd; |
| int bz2err; |
| uint8_t header[24]; |
| uint8_t *old, *newff; |
| int64_t oldsize, newsize; |
| BZFILE* bz2; |
| struct bspatch_stream stream; |
| struct stat sb; |
| |
| //if(argc!=4) errx(1,"usage: %s oldfile newfile patchfile\n",argv[0]); |
| |
| /* Open patch file */ |
| if ((f = fopen(patch, "r")) == NULL){ |
| //err(1, "fopen(%s)", patch); |
| return -1; |
| } |
| |
| /* Read header */ |
| if (fread(header, 1, 24, f) != 24) { |
| return -1; |
| /* |
| if (feof(f)) |
| errx(1, "Corrupt patch\n"); |
| err(1, "fread(%s)", argv[3]); |
| */ |
| } |
| |
| /* Check for appropriate magic */ |
| if (memcmp(header, "ENDSLEY/BSDIFF43", 16) != 0) |
| errx(1, "Corrupt patch\n"); |
| |
| /* Read lengths from header */ |
| newsize=offtin(header+16); |
| if(newsize<0) |
| errx(1,"Corrupt patch\n"); |
| |
| /* Close patch file and re-open it via libbzip2 at the right places */ |
| if(((fd=open(oldfile,O_RDONLY,0))<0) || |
| ((oldsize=lseek(fd,0,SEEK_END))==-1) || |
| ((old=malloc(oldsize+1))==NULL) || |
| (lseek(fd,0,SEEK_SET)!=0) || |
| (read(fd,old,oldsize)!=oldsize) || |
| (fstat(fd, &sb)) || |
| (close(fd)==-1)) { |
| return -2; |
| // err(1,"%s",argv[1]); |
| } |
| if((newff=malloc(newsize+1))==NULL) err(1,NULL); |
| |
| if (NULL == (bz2 = BZ2_bzReadOpen(&bz2err, f, 0, 0, NULL, 0))) |
| errx(1, "BZ2_bzReadOpen, bz2err=%d", bz2err); |
| |
| stream.read = bz2_read; |
| stream.opaque = bz2; |
| if (bspatch(old, oldsize, newff, newsize, &stream)) |
| errx(1, "bspatch"); |
| |
| /* Clean up the bzip2 reads */ |
| BZ2_bzReadClose(&bz2err, bz2); |
| fclose(f); |
| |
| /* Write the new file */ |
| if(((fd=open(newfile,O_CREAT|O_TRUNC|O_WRONLY,sb.st_mode))<0) || |
| (write(fd,newff,newsize)!=newsize) || (close(fd)==-1)) |
| { |
| return -3; |
| //err(1,"%s",argv[2]); |
| } |
| |
| free(newff); |
| free(old); |
| |
| return 0; |
| } |
